More about the book

The book delves into the shaman's role as a healer, bridging the gap between the living and the spirit world, with a rich exploration of diverse cultural practices from Siberia to the Amazon. It features 250 illustrations, including many in color, alongside 25 maps that enhance the understanding of shamanic traditions across different regions.
